Soda, Car Trouble & Dad Decisions | The Mental Load of Fatherhood
This week’s episode starts with a simple question: “Why do we still drink soda with so much sugar when there are so many alternatives?” But before we can finish the debate, Travis’s car mechanic calls with some bad (and expensive) news.
From there, we dive into:
🚘 Travis’s current truck troubles and dealing with the local mechanic
🤔 The hidden cost of decision-making as dads (time, money, energy)
💡 Rob’s take on “decision fatigue” and why even small choices can feel heavy
🧠 The mental load of fatherhood and how it shows up in daily life
🔥 Hot take of the week: “Guys shouldn’t pee standing up at home” (yep, we went there)
Being a dad means balancing car repairs, soda debates, family dynamics, and the constant stream of choices. At the end of the day, doing your best and moving forward with intention matters most.
